The Scheduler/Planner is responsible for developing, maintaining, and executing the Master Production Schedule (MPS) to ensure customer orders are delivered safely, on time, within budget, and in accordance with quality standards. This role coordinates production schedules, labor capacity, material availability, and manufacturing priorities by working closely with Customer Service, Engineering, Purchasing, Materials, Inventory, and Operations.

The Scheduler/Planner proactively identifies capacity constraints, adjusts production schedules to accommodate changing business needs, supports Sales & Operations Planning (S&OP), and drives continuous improvement initiatives that improve manufacturing efficiency, inventory performance, and on-time delivery.

  • Develop, maintain, and execute the Master Production Schedule (MPS) to meet customer delivery requirements while optimizing labor, equipment, and material resources.
  • Coordinate production schedules based on customer orders, sales forecasts, material availability, production capacity, and manufacturing priorities.
  • Serve as the primary liaison between Customer Service, Engineering, Product Line Management, Purchasing, Inventory Control, Materials Planning, and Operations to ensure timely order fulfillment.
  • Conduct daily production scheduling meetings with Operations to review production priorities, new orders, schedule changes, and manufacturing constraints.
  • Monitor production progress and adjust schedules as necessary to respond to changing customer requirements, material shortages, equipment downtime, or capacity limitations.
  • Analyze production capacity and recommend overtime, staffing adjustments, or schedule modifications to support customer commitments.
  • Maintain accurate planning data, routings, lead times, work centers, and capacity information within the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P/MRP) system.
  • Coordinate with Materials Planning, Purchasing, Kitting, and Inventory Control to ensure material availability aligns with production schedules.
  • Monitor production performance, schedule attainment, backlog, inventory levels, and on-time delivery metrics, recommending improvements when needed.
  • Establish and communicate production lead times for standard and engineered products.
  • Expedite production and material shortages by coordinating cross-functional solutions to minimize schedule disruptions.
  • Develop and maintain Kanban systems and inventory replenishment strategies for raw materials, work-in-process, semi-finished goods, and finished goods.
  • Support new product introductions, engineering changes, and product transitions through effective production planning.
  • Prepare production schedules, planning reports, and operational metrics for management.
  • Participate in Sales & Operations Planning (S&OP) activities by providing production capacity and scheduling information.
  • Identify opportunities to improve production planning, scheduling processes, inventory management, and manufacturing efficiency.

Valmont Industries began in 1946 when our founder, Robert B. Daugherty combined his $5,000 savings and wholehearted belief that business could and should be done better. Since that modest start more than half a century ago, our company has grown to be an international leader in engineered products and services for infrastructure and water-conserving irrigation equipment for agriculture. From the lighting and traffic structures that guide your way, to communication towers and utility structures that power your home and business, to irrigation equipment that waters the croplands on which your food is grown, Valmont products improve lives worldwide.
